Bio:
2014 : In Septembre, on the village of Ferlens (CH), after the end of his band « Helllander », Kevin Van Raiser decide to make a new band with Jerem TheOak on the drums. During two month, Raiser creates the first songs then work it with Jerem. Without a bass player yet, it’s Slayde (former member of Helllander) who play the bass.In Novembre Chainer is playing for the first time on stage at the festival « Fire’n’Steel » on Moudon (CH). It’s just after this gigs that Axel Whiteman join the band as a bass player, then now the line-up of Chainer is complete. 2015 : The band gets be successfull and play regulary on stage in Switzerland and also in France. In July, the musicians move their practice room to Moudon. During August, Chainer record his first album at Morphoenix Studio on Collonge-sous-Salève (FR). For this occasion, Natacha the singer from the band « Shezoo » from Zurich record in duet with Van Raiser the song « Burn the City ». It’s on December 18 that Chainer out his first album called « Orgasmo Mechanic », producced by Van Raiser and Whiteman, with the video of the song « Hungry » directed by Virginie Travaglini. A second video is announced for 2016, directed by Michael Starke, for the song Burn the City with Natacha. 2016 : Still playing on stage, Chainer is working on a new futur album. But, it's not easy with Jerem for the rest of the band. After long reflection, Raiser and Whiteman decide to fire their drummer on March 6. Immediately, they announce the news and start to search a new drummer. One week later, Chainer find his new drummer. Welcome to Yvan.The ride continues...

Album:
At "Opening" the principle "nomen est omen" applies. It is a 70 second intro track. You can hear an acoustic guitar, which serves us tender, "country-like" sounds. In the background the sound of the wind can be heard. It almost feels like being in a western movie. The hero faces his rival for the final shooting duel at noon. Immediately it pops. At the subsequent "Feel On Fire" bassist Axel Whiteman is the first to open the fire. This is followed by classic heavy metal riffs and Kevin Van Raiser's distinctive vocal organ is heard for the first time. Somehow, Joel O'Keeffe (Airbourne) is in there too. A catchy, solid story. That makes the guys really strong. Of course, a feasible sing-along chorus may not be missing. Towards the end of the song, the guitar solo lovers will also get their money's worth. Drummer Yvan tempoises on "Gorgeous And Dangerous". With a nice, shrill scream, the wild ride starts. Pure Metal in pure culture! Parallels to Enforcer, W.A.S.P., Mötley Crüe or Skull Fist are absolutely given. Of course, a band with this style must dedicate a few songs to the female gender. We all know very well that our girls can be both beautiful and dangerous. Powerful riffs and rapid pace characterize the next track "Desire". In places suddenly there are also keyboard melodies to be heard. However, these fit perfectly into the existing song structure. No doubt a number with hymn potential. Chains let the chains rattle. Definitely a hint of this silver piece. Even with "High Wild Ride" is again pressed with full vigor on the accelerator. This track could just as easily be found on an Airbourne record. The number is in a good mood. Chainer drive clearly in the fast lane. The competition remains only the view of the taillights. «Angel» is the longest song of the album with a playing time of 05:08 minutes. The trio has already released a music video. In it, all heavy metal clichés are served well. You can see hot ovens, sexy chicks and genre-usual poses en masse. In spite of the short hallelujah singing at the beginning, it soon becomes clear that this is not going to be really sacred. I can fully understand why the band chose this piece to be the appropriate video clip candidate. "No God No Master" also comes around the corner with a lot of speed. However, the thing can not quite keep up with the level of the preceding numbers. Unfortunately, I cant really get out of the slippers this time. Did I think so? The obligatory ballad was missing! These deliver us Chainer with «Lone Rider». A welcome relief. Time for a short break. The acoustic guitar sounds put you right in the right mood. Kevin and his buddies prove to the audience that they can take it easy. Fits. Take out lighters and enjoy. Clear the stage track. "Ball's Kicker" includes some monster riffs. That's what I like. Undoubtedly a number for the headbanging crowd. This kick sits in the heart. A worthy and successful completion of the regular album part. Now it's still an extra round. The definitive album finale is the bonus track "Stars". This is a feature between Chainer and the Brothers And Sisters Of Rock'n Roll. Behind it are musicians of various Swiss bands. The song itself is a cover version. The original is from the charity music project Hear 'n Aid from 1985. Strippenzieher behind this whole story was metal god Ronnie James Dio. The reinterpretation is basically a good idea. However, the Chainer variant can not quite keep up with the original. CONCLUSIONS Chainer take classic Heavy Metal to the chest and breathe new life into "Ball's Kicker". Fast-paced hymns, crisp riffs and a matching vocal organ give the story the right spice. I wish the boys that they can overcome the limit of the "Röschtigrabens" and raise their level of awareness appropriately. This would be deserved after the release of such a cool disc anyway.
